//! deletes all dynamic lights there are
void COpenGLDriver::deleteAllDynamicLights()
{
for (s32 i=0; i<MaxLights; ++i)
glDisable(GL_LIGHT0 + i);
RequestedLights.clear();
CNullDriver::deleteAllDynamicLights();
}
//! adds a dynamic light
s32 COpenGLDriver::addDynamicLight(const SLight& light)
{
CNullDriver::addDynamicLight(light);
RequestedLights.push_back(RequestedLight(light));
u32 newLightIndex = RequestedLights.size() - 1;
// Try and assign a hardware light just now, but don't worry if I can't
assignHardwareLight(newLightIndex);
return (s32)newLightIndex;
}
void COpenGLDriver::assignHardwareLight(u32 lightIndex)
{
setTransform(ETS_WORLD, core::matrix4());
s32 lidx;
for (lidx=GL_LIGHT0; lidx < GL_LIGHT0 + MaxLights; ++lidx)
{
if(!glIsEnabled(lidx))
{
RequestedLights[lightIndex].HardwareLightIndex = lidx;
break;
}
}
if(lidx == GL_LIGHT0 + MaxLights) // There's no room for it just now
return;
GLfloat data[4];
const SLight & light = RequestedLights[lightIndex].LightData;
switch (light.Type)
{
case video::ELT_SPOT:
data[0] = light.Direction.X;
data[1] = light.Direction.Y;
data[2] = light.Direction.Z;
data[3] = 0.0f;
glLightfv(lidx, GL_SPOT_DIRECTION, data);
// set position
data[0] = light.Position.X;
data[1] = light.Position.Y;
data[2] = light.Position.Z;
data[3] = 1.0f; // 1.0f for positional light
glLightfv(lidx, GL_POSITION, data);
glLightf(lidx, GL_SPOT_EXPONENT, light.Falloff);
glLightf(lidx, GL_SPOT_CUTOFF, light.OuterCone);
break;
case video::ELT_POINT:
// set position
data[0] = light.Position.X;
data[1] = light.Position.Y;
data[2] = light.Position.Z;
data[3] = 1.0f; // 1.0f for positional light
glLightfv(lidx, GL_POSITION, data);
glLightf(lidx, GL_SPOT_EXPONENT, 0.0f);
glLightf(lidx, GL_SPOT_CUTOFF, 180.0f);
break;
case video::ELT_DIRECTIONAL:
// set direction
data[0] = -light.Direction.X;
data[1] = -light.Direction.Y;
data[2] = -light.Direction.Z;
data[3] = 0.0f; // 0.0f for directional light
glLightfv(lidx, GL_POSITION, data);
glLightf(lidx, GL_SPOT_EXPONENT, 0.0f);
glLightf(lidx, GL_SPOT_CUTOFF, 180.0f);
break;
default:
break;
}
// set diffuse color
data[0] = light.DiffuseColor.r;
data[1] = light.DiffuseColor.g;
data[2] = light.DiffuseColor.b;
data[3] = light.DiffuseColor.a;
glLightfv(lidx, GL_DIFFUSE, data);
// set specular color
data[0] = light.SpecularColor.r;
data[1] = light.SpecularColor.g;
data[2] = light.SpecularColor.b;
data[3] = light.SpecularColor.a;
glLightfv(lidx, GL_SPECULAR, data);
// set ambient color
data[0] = light.AmbientColor.r;
data[1] = light.AmbientColor.g;
data[2] = light.AmbientColor.b;
data[3] = light.AmbientColor.a;
glLightfv(lidx, GL_AMBIENT, data);
// 1.0f / (constant + linear * d + quadratic*(d*d);
// set attenuation
glLightf(lidx, GL_CONSTANT_ATTENUATION, light.Attenuation.X);
glLightf(lidx, GL_LINEAR_ATTENUATION, light.Attenuation.Y);
glLightf(lidx, GL_QUADRATIC_ATTENUATION, light.Attenuation.Z);
glEnable(lidx);
}
//! Turns a dynamic light on or off
//! \param lightIndex: the index returned by addDynamicLight
//! \param turnOn: true to turn the light on, false to turn it off
void COpenGLDriver::turnLightOn(s32 lightIndex, bool turnOn)
{
if(lightIndex < 0 || lightIndex >= (s32)RequestedLights.size())
return;
RequestedLight & requestedLight = RequestedLights[lightIndex];
requestedLight.DesireToBeOn = turnOn;
if(turnOn)
{
if(-1 == requestedLight.HardwareLightIndex)
assignHardwareLight(lightIndex);
}
else
{
if(-1 != requestedLight.HardwareLightIndex)
{
// It's currently assigned, so free up the hardware light
glDisable(requestedLight.HardwareLightIndex);
requestedLight.HardwareLightIndex = -1;
// Now let the first light that's waiting on a free hardware light grab it
for(u32 requested = 0; requested < RequestedLights.size(); ++requested)
if(RequestedLights[requested].DesireToBeOn
&&
-1 == RequestedLights[requested].HardwareLightIndex)
{
assignHardwareLight(requested);
break;
}
}
}
}
